Choosing the Right Size for Your Edge Banding: A Comprehensive Guide309
As a leading Chinese manufacturer of edge banding, we frequently receive inquiries about the appropriate size for various applications. The question, "How big should my edge banding be?" is deceptively simple. The ideal size isn't a one-size-fits-all answer; it depends heavily on several crucial factors. This guide will delve into these factors, helping you choose the perfect edge banding size for your specific needs.
The most fundamental consideration is the thickness of your substrate. This is the material your edge banding will be applied to, typically particleboard, MDF (medium-density fiberboard), plywood, or solid wood. Thicker substrates generally require thicker edge banding for a more robust and visually appealing finish. A thin edge band on a thick substrate will look disproportionate and may even be prone to chipping or damage. Conversely, an overly thick edge band on a thin substrate will look bulky and unwieldy. A good rule of thumb is to match the edge banding thickness to the substrate thickness, or to choose a slightly thicker banding (e.g., 1-2mm thicker) for enhanced durability.
The type of substrate also plays a crucial role. Particleboard, with its porous nature, might benefit from a slightly thicker edge banding to mask imperfections and provide a more consistent surface. MDF, being denser, can often accommodate a thinner edge band. Solid wood, depending on its species and finish, might require a specific thickness to complement its inherent aesthetic.
The intended use of the finished product is another critical factor. Furniture intended for high-traffic areas, such as kitchen cabinets or dining tables, will demand a more durable edge banding, likely thicker and possibly made from a more resistant material like PVC or ABS. Less frequently used pieces, such as decorative shelves, can utilize a thinner, more aesthetically-focused edge banding. Consider the potential for impacts, scratches, and general wear and tear when selecting the thickness.
Visual aesthetics shouldn't be overlooked. Thicker edge banding can create a bolder, more substantial look, while thinner banding contributes to a cleaner, more minimalist aesthetic. The overall design of the furniture piece should guide your choice. A sleek modern design might prefer a thinner edge band, whereas a more traditional style might benefit from a thicker one. The color and texture of the edge banding should also complement the substrate and overall design.
The application method influences the edge banding choice. Some thicker edge banding may be more challenging to apply using certain techniques, particularly manual methods. Thinner edge banding is often easier to work with, especially for beginners. Consider your skill level and the equipment available when choosing a thickness. Professional machinery can handle thicker banding more easily.
The edge banding material itself also influences the ideal size. PVC edge banding, known for its durability and resistance to moisture and chemicals, comes in various thicknesses. ABS edge banding offers similar properties. Melamine edge banding, while more economical, might be limited in thickness options and is often better suited for thinner substrates. The material's inherent properties will dictate its suitability for different thicknesses and applications.
Let's consider some specific examples:
* Kitchen cabinets: Given the high-traffic and potential for moisture exposure, a 2mm or even 3mm PVC edge banding is often preferred.
* Office desks: A 1mm or 2mm PVC or ABS edge banding would usually suffice.
* Bedroom furniture: Depending on the style and desired look, a 1mm to 2mm edge band in PVC, ABS, or melamine could be suitable.
* Coffee tables: A thinner edge banding (1mm) might be chosen for a cleaner, more modern aesthetic.
Ultimately, the "right" size for your edge banding is a balance between functionality and aesthetics. Consider the thickness of your substrate, the material's properties, the intended use of the furniture, and the desired visual effect. Remember to account for post-processing like sanding and finishing when selecting your edge banding thickness. These processes may slightly alter the final dimensions.
